Paula M. Hoover

Feb 25, 1961 - Sep 25, 2025

Sandusky

Paula M. Hoover, 64, residing in Sandusky, entered her heavenly home Thursday, September 25, 2025, at Stein Hospice Care Center, surrounded by her loving family.

Paula was born February 25, 1961, in Sandusky, to the late Paul Phillips and Jessie (Cordle) Clifton.

Paula's greatest joy in life was her family, whom she will forever be cherished by. She is survived by her children, April (Joe) Ring, Adam Phillips, Melissa Alvarez, Michael Hoover, and Cheyenne Hoover; her devoted husband of 42 years, Gary Hoover; eight beloved grandchildren; her sister, Linda Herrmann; brother, Jerry Clifton; and special nieces, Carol Matheny, Amanda Dillery, and Kandy Pedoli. She also leaves behind a host of other loving relatives and dear friends.

In addition to her parents, Paula is preceded in death by her brothers, Bill and Larry Clifton.

A Celebration of Life will be at a later date. Groff Funeral Homes & Crematory is assisting family with arrangements.

Those wishing to contribute to Paula's memory may do so to Stein Hospice Services, 1200 Sycamore Line, Sandusky, OH 44870.
